“Confirmation is a special outpouring of the Holy Spirit like that of Pentecost. This outpouring impresses upon the soul an indelible character and produces a growth in the grace of Baptism. It roots us more deeply in divine kinship, binds us more firmly to Christ and to the Church, and reinvigorates the gifts of the Holy Spirit in our soul” (268).
For teens, the two-year preparation for the Sacrament of Confirmation is done through the Youth Ministry Confirmation program and is normally begun in 9th Grade of High School. During the second year, as well as regular formation sessions, those preparing for Confirmation participate in monthly sessions with their sponsor, complete a service project, and take part in a retreat.
